Causes of forehead wrinkles

The frontalis muscle is located above the forehead, it raises the eyebrows and the bridge of the nose. It also pulls the scalp forward, forming transverse and longitudinal folds. The facial muscle structure is closely related to the human integument. When the supracranial fibers move, the skin in the forehead area stretches.

Wrinkles can form for two reasons. Active facial expressions cause eyebrows to rise or frown on the bridge of the nose. Aging processes lead to a decrease in the amount of collagen. After relaxation, the epidermis does not smooth out completely, muscle fibers lose elasticity, and creases form.

As the muscle tone of the forehead decreases, the eyebrows and oval begin to droop. Drooping eyelids, jowls, and a double chin appear. Therefore, face-building for the forehead is of great importance in anti-aging programs.

Reasons for the formation of frontal wrinkles:

  1. age-related changes;
  2. increased emotionality;
  3. stress;
  4. smoking, alcohol;
  5. violation of work and rest schedules;
  6. sudden weight fluctuations;
  7. unfavorable environmental conditions;
  8. lack or improper skin care;
  9. deficiency of vitamins, minerals;
  10. pathologies of the endocrine system.

Attention! Creases can occur due to incorrect selection of glasses or lenses. Weather conditions also have an impact - gusty winds, scorching sun, snow. It is impossible to eliminate all provoking factors, but by increasing the elasticity of the fibers, it will be possible to smooth out wrinkles.

Preparation

Before you begin gymnastics for the face against wrinkles, the skin needs to be cleansed. This stage is very important, because during exercise, toxins will be actively released. To remove makeup, you can use cosmetic milk, thermal water or alcohol-free toner. Afterwards, you can apply a light moisturizing fluid or grape or peach oil, especially if the skin is dry and irritated.

Be sure to wash your hands; they will also participate in facial exercises.

General execution rules

Execution rules:

  1. Anti-wrinkle gymnastics should be performed in front of a mirror for the first time, this will allow you to monitor the precise execution of the technique;
  2. you need to sit straight, you cannot lean towards the mirror, otherwise you may get new wrinkles;
  3. during execution, 1 muscle group works, all the rest are in a relaxed state, when additional ones are activated, it is necessary to fix it with your palms;
  4. after training, you need to cleanse your face, you can use flower water and apply a nourishing cream;
  5. can be performed with makeup, but these should be exceptional cases; the tone or powder must be washed off;
  6. after each exercise against wrinkles on the forehead, you need to relax the fibers, to do this, exhale with the sound “pff”, your lips should vibrate slightly;
  7. It is recommended to practice facelift no earlier than 30 minutes before applying makeup, and no later than an hour before bedtime.

Important point! The main criterion for correctly performing gymnastics for wrinkles on the forehead and bridge of the nose is the appearance of mild fatigue and a burning sensation. This occurs under the influence of lactic acid, synthesized during maximum muscle work. All exercises are performed 5 to 10 times.

Set of exercises



fejsbilding-ot-morshin-na-lbu-iJZenQm.webp

The main set of exercises to eliminate wrinkles on the forehead involves performing facial gymnastics in the following sequence:

  1. Warm-up for the face - open and close your eyes and mouth at the same time. It is important to ensure that the eyebrows do not rise and that creases do not form in the area of ​​the nasolabial triangle.
  2. Warming up the neck is necessary to activate blood flow to the head. Circular movements to the right, left, tilts - forward, backward, left, right.
  3. The exercise is recommended for working the frontalis muscle and raising the brow arches. Place your palms on your forehead, lightly pressing against the skull bone. Forcefully raise and lower your eyebrows, overcoming the resistance of your palms.
  4. Effective for smoothing out wrinkles on the bridge of the nose and vertical creases. Place your palms in a house, the central part of the forehead and the bridge of the nose are open. Raise your eyebrows, feeling resistance.
  5. Place your palm on your forehead, hold the arches, raise your eyebrows along with your ear muscles.
  6. Place the fingers of both hands, except the thumbs, on the forehead, at the beginning of the eyebrows, as if continuing the line of the bridge of the nose. Look down, while inhaling, raise your eyes up, exhaling. At the same time, tighten the skin a few millimeters with your fingers, slightly smoothing it towards the temples.
  7. Fix the palm vertically above the eyebrow area. As you inhale, lower your eyes down, and as you exhale, look up. At the same time, using your palm, pull the bridge of your nose towards your hairline.

These exercises will allow you to smooth out longitudinal and transverse folds on the forehead and bridge of the nose. The complex includes both strength and stretching exercises, which will speed up the results. The first changes can be noticed after 2-3 weeks of daily training in the morning and evening. It may take about six months to correct deep wrinkles. Afterwards, it is enough to maintain the result - 3-4 times a week.

Face builders and everyone who is not indifferent to beauty, today I will tell you about training the forehead area. First, a little anatomy.

Occipitofrontal muscle covers the arch from the eyebrows in front to the highest nuchal line in the back. This muscle has a frontal belly (venter frontalis) and an occipital belly (venter occipitalis), connected to each other by a tendon helmet (galea aponeurotica, s. aponeurosis epicranialis), which occupies an intermediate position and covers the parietal region of the head.

Frontal abdomen more developed than the occipital. Unlike the occipital abdomen, the muscle bundles of the frontal abdomen are not attached to the bones of the skull, but are woven into the skin of the eyebrows. Therefore, the forehead is a very mobile part of the face and is susceptible to early wrinkles and creases of facial origin.

Corrugator muscle (m.corrugator supercilii), begins on the medial segment of the superciliary arch, passes upward and is laterally attached to the skin of the corresponding eyebrow. Some of the bundles of this muscle are intertwined with the bundles of the orbicularis oculi muscle. This muscle pulls the skin of the forehead down and medially, resulting in two vertical folds above the root of the nose.

Muscle of the proud (m.procerus) begins on the outer surface of the nasal bone, its bundles extend upward and end in the skin of the forehead; some of them are intertwined with fascicles of the frontal abdomen. When the procerus muscle contracts, transverse grooves and folds are formed at the root of the nose.

Exercise No. 1 Raising eyebrows up

Place your fingers above your eyebrows. Push your eyebrows up with force, using your fingers to resist. Make sure that during the exercise there are no horizontal wrinkles on the forehead, try to relax your shoulders and lower them down, tightly fix the skin above the eyebrows.

After completing the exercise, tap your fingers on your forehead.

Effect: The eyebrow lifting exercise strengthens the frontalis muscle, lifts and tones the eyebrow arches, and protects the forehead from the formation of wrinkles.

Exercise No. 2 Bringing together eyebrows

Place your ring fingers under your eyebrows, your middle fingers above your eyebrows, your index fingers next to each other, with your fingers facing outward. Make a sad/upset expression on your face. The bridge of the nose wrinkles, the eyebrows creep down towards the center. Now fix your forehead and eyebrows with your palms. Repeat the grimace. You will feel tension in the central part of the forehead and eyebrows. No creases or folds should form.

Effect: wrinkles at the inner bases of the eyebrows are smoothed out.

Exercise No. 3. Muscle of the proud

We place our palms in a triangle, leaving a small space above the bridge of the nose, and try to lift only the central part of the forehead from the bridge of the nose upward. Make sure that during the exercise there are no horizontal wrinkles on the forehead and vertical wrinkles between the eyebrows.

Effect: training the proud muscles prevents the appearance of a transverse fold on the bridge of the nose, smoothes out vertical wrinkles between the eyebrows.

Exercise No. 4. Eyebrow angles up

We fix the center of the forehead with our palms. Raise only the corners of the eyebrows up and to the sides. Try pulling your ears up in this exercise.

Effect: The exercise helps to lift the drooping outer corners of the eyebrows upward and improves the shape of the eyebrow arch.

The forehead muscles take part in such emotions as amazement, surprise, admiration, fear, effort, disgust, etc. The forehead is a very active part of our face, therefore a positive result directly depends on the control of facial expressions. You can read about facial control in this article.

With regular training of the forehead area, it is possible to remove horizontal wrinkles, vertical wrinkles between the eyebrows, prevent and correct a fold on the bridge of the nose, strengthen the muscle frame, and restore the position of the eyebrow arch.

Like everything else in our body and appearance, the forehead ages over time. Age-related changes appear on it, more often they are expressed in changes in the quality of the skin and in the appearance of wrinkles on it. It is generally accepted that the forehead muscles weaken over time, which is why folds form in this area. However, the real reason for the formation of wrinkles on the forehead, on the contrary, lies in the hypertonicity of the frontal muscles, which, when clenched, form those very hated folds. To relieve this spasm, training that includes exercises for the forehead against wrinkles is well suited.

Causes of forehead wrinkles

There are different approaches to performing forehead gymnastics. For example, face-building for the forehead suggests strengthening and pumping up weakened muscles; Cantienika, Revitonics and Osmionics, on the contrary, recommend relaxing them. Having studied the works of gurus in various areas of facial practice, we came to the conclusion that it is better not to pump up already spasmodic muscles, but, on the contrary, to help them relax.

Due to the fact that during active facial movements the forehead muscles actively work, muscle spasms occur in these places, for example, between the eyebrows and in the center of the forehead. Deep folds are formed there and creases appear on the skin.

In general, in addition to the frontal muscles, other muscles in the face, head and neck also spasm, leading to an imbalance in the entire muscular system. Hypertonicity of some muscles causes weakening of the tone of others. Due to such changes, a person’s appearance changes, reflected in all areas of the face and body as a whole: swelling appears, eyes droop, eyebrows and corners of lips droop, wrinkles appear around the mouth, facial features are distorted.

Therefore, to prevent and slow down the aging process, as well as to restore the tone of the forehead muscles, it is good to carry out relaxation, relaxation of the forehead muscles with the help of exercises, taping and massage with vacuum cans, and not, as is often said, pumping them up.

Contraindications to performing gymnastics for the forehead

If you have any open wounds or problems with facial muscles, then the practice is contraindicated for you. Otherwise, doing forehead relaxation exercises will benefit everyone.

Forehead massage should be done with caution for those who have blocked the functioning of its muscles with Botox injections. In this case, it is recommended to first consult a cosmetologist.
